72 research outputs found

    Counterexample-Guided Polynomial Loop Invariant Generation by Lagrange Interpolation

    Full text link
    We apply multivariate Lagrange interpolation to synthesize polynomial quantitative loop invariants for probabilistic programs. We reduce the computation of an quantitative loop invariant to solving constraints over program variables and unknown coefficients. Lagrange interpolation allows us to find constraints with less unknown coefficients. Counterexample-guided refinement furthermore generates linear constraints that pinpoint the desired quantitative invariants. We evaluate our technique by several case studies with polynomial quantitative loop invariants in the experiments

    Applying machine learning to the problem of choosing a heuristic to select the variable ordering for cylindrical algebraic decomposition

    Get PDF
    Cylindrical algebraic decomposition(CAD) is a key tool in computational algebraic geometry, particularly for quantifier elimination over real-closed fields. When using CAD, there is often a choice for the ordering placed on the variables. This can be important, with some problems infeasible with one variable ordering but easy with another. Machine learning is the process of fitting a computer model to a complex function based on properties learned from measured data. In this paper we use machine learning (specifically a support vector machine) to select between heuristics for choosing a variable ordering, outperforming each of the separate heuristics.Comment: 16 page

    Certified Computer Algebra on top of an Interactive Theorem Prover

    Get PDF
    Contains fulltext : 35027.pdf (publisher's version ) (Open Access

    Green's functions for parabolic systems of second order in time-varying domains

    Full text link
    We construct Green's functions for divergence form, second order parabolic systems in non-smooth time-varying domains whose boundaries are locally represented as graph of functions that are Lipschitz continuous in the spatial variables and 1/2-H\"older continuous in the time variable, under the assumption that weak solutions of the system satisfy an interior H\"older continuity estimate. We also derive global pointwise estimates for Green's function in such time-varying domains under the assumption that weak solutions of the system vanishing on a portion of the boundary satisfy a certain local boundedness estimate and a local H\"older continuity estimate. In particular, our results apply to complex perturbations of a single real equation.Comment: 25 pages, 0 figur

    Solving Geometric Problems with Real Quantifier Elimination

    No full text
    Many problems arising in real geometry can be formulated as first-order formulas. Thus quantifier elimination can be used to solve these problems. In this note, we discuss the applicability of implemented quantifier elimination algorithms for solving geometrical problems. In particular, we demonstrate how the tools of redlog can be applied to solve a real implicitization problem, namely the Enneper surface

    Can mitochondria from proplastids be differentiated?

    No full text
    corecore